I got bored on day after finishing some of my figures and decided to flock some of my figures, I was workin on my Raider when I thought of adding destroyed terrain.
After fiddling around I thought about the pictures I’ve seen of crumbling walls/roads/etc… I figured I would try a shot at it.

I decided to use the spare sprues I had to model out some walls of a traditional red-brick city, similar to that of the Old Town part of the city where I live.

After some work I got this:
